2.1 捕捉多个异常 在一个except语句只捕捉其后声明的异常类型,如果可能会抛出的是其他类型的异常就需要再增加一个except语句了,或者也可以指定一个更通用的异常类型比如:Exception,如下: #-- coding: utf-8 --try:print2/'0'exceptZeroDivisionError:print'除数不能为0'exceptException:print'其他类型异常' 为了捕获...
4、如果在程序运行时出现其他异常,该异常对象总是Exception 类或其子类的实例, Python将调用 Exception 对应 except 块处理该异常。 注意:我们在进行异常捕获时,应该把父类异常的except块放在子类except块的后面,即先处理小异常后处理大异常。 4、多异常捕获 我们可以想一下,如果产生不同的异常时,我们想要用同样的...
1、捕获多种类型的异常 A、 C#使用catch语句只能捕获Exception类及其子类的对象。 B、 Catch只能有一个参数,即一条catch语句只能捕获此参数限定的那种类型的异常。 C、 在某个try块后有两个不同的catch块捕获两个相同类型的异常是语法错误。 D、 越特殊的异常类型放在越前面。 2、异常处理机制: A、.NET4.0默认...
2. 异常捕获 当发生异常时,我们就需要对异常进行捕获,然后进行相应的处理。python的异常捕获常用try...except...结构,把可能发生错误的语句放在try模块里,用except来处理异常,每一个try,都必须至少对应一个except。此外,与python异常相关的关键字主要有: 2.1 捕获所有异常 包括键盘中断和程序退出请求(用sys.exit()...
6.3.4 指定Load或Store指令的地址 6.3.5 访问多个内存位置 6.3.6 非特权访问 6.3.7 预取内存 6.3.9 内存访问的原子性 6.3.10 内存屏障和栅栏指令 6.3.11 同步原语 6.4 流程控制 6.5 系统控制和其他指令 6.5.1 异常处理指令 6.5.2 系统寄存器访问 6.5.3 调试指令 6.5.4 提示指令 6.5....
虎门大桥发生异常抖动 已双向全封闭 术后打呼噜 后来退了婚 粽子连锁店空降“霸道女总裁” 原来是个骗子! 重庆“棒棒”冉光辉 吃苦耐劳赢得好口碑 重庆“棒棒”冉光辉 为儿子扛出一片天 做好防护积极复工 未来有希望 初一初二即将复课 学校多点多面保安全 你家的电梯年检了吗? 电梯检测环节多 安全用梯人人有责 ...
在捕获异常时,可以根据异常类型进行不同的处理逻辑,例如记录日志、给用户友好的错误提示、进行重试等。异常类的继承结构使得异常处理更加灵活和可定制,有助于提高程序的容错性和可维护性。 1.2 try-catch 块 在C#中,try-catch块是用于异常处理的重要结构。try-catch块允许我们编写代码来捕获和处理可能发生的异常,...
四、异常处理原则 五、工作过程中总结的使用try的注意事项 六、禁用e.printStackTrace() 七、trycatch内代码越少越好吗? 八、即时编译器 传统的try-catch异常处理是否是编程语言发展中的弯路? 在Java的世界里,如果代码发生了异常,而未捕获异常,程序会崩溃,相对于程序崩溃,多写几行代码显得就有点无足轻重了。通过...
CDK4/6 抑制剂联合内分泌治疗导致的肝功能异常多为无症状的转氨酶升高,达尔西利因引入了哌啶结构,消除了谷胱甘肽捕获风险,较少引起 3 级转氨酶升高。 (3)CDK4/6 抑制剂相关性腹泻: 腹泻是 CDK4/6 抑制剂最常见的胃肠道不良反应,主要原因是 CDK4/6 抑制剂对 CDK9 的抑制。腹泻大多发生在用药早期,随着治疗...
另一种选择是try-with-resource语句 如果资源实现AutoCloseable接口,则可以使用它。这就是大多数Java标准资源所做的事情。当你在try子句中打开资源时,它将在try块执行后自动关闭,或者处理异常。 public void automaticallyCloseResource() { File file = new File("./tmp.txt"); ...